Cult Of The Groundhog

Today was Groundhog Day! Punxsutawney Phil, the world's most famous climate predicting rodent, states that we will have 6 more weeks of winter. I wouldn't say that's a bad thing, since we've been having a very mild winter in NY so far, don't ya' think?

I did a little research and watched this video from Netscape.com - the fat little hairy guy in the picture is named after the town in Pennsylvania where they perform the ceremony, and they've been doing it since 1886 (hopefully with more than one groundhog by now). The slightly larger guy in the top hat is a member of the "Inner Circle," a disturbingly-sounding cult-like name for a group of well-dressed, older gentlemen who have dedicated a good portion of their public life to running this ceremony once a year and taking care of the idolised ball of fur. If you visit Groundhog.org, you can see to 20+ members of the Inner Circle, and can wonder like me, why it takes so many men to feed one groundhog.
